How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Winkler Preserve?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Winkler Preserve Studio Apartments | $1,403 | $899 | $2,564 |
| Winkler Preserve 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,596 | $999 | $1,890 |
| Winkler Preserve 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,915 | $1,100 | $3,699 |
| Winkler Preserve 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,534 | $1,560 | $3,325 |
| Winkler Preserve 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,920 | $1,920 | $1,920 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Winkler Preserve?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$2,856 | $1,200 | $8,700 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$2,998 | $1,400 | $10,000+ |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$4,130 | $2,050 | $7,500 |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$4,350 | $4,350 | $4,350 |
